Notes on affine isometric actions of discrete groups

Abstract: Consider a lattice Gamma in a group G=SL2(R),SO(1,n),SU(1,n), SL2(Qp). We discuss actions of Gamma by affine isometric transformations of Hilbert spaces. We show that for irreducible affine isometric action of G its restriction to Gamma is irreducible. We prove the existence of canonical irreducible affine isometric actions of Gamma associated to actions of Gamma on R- trees. Using such actions we construct irreducible representations of semigroup of probabilistic measures on Gamma and construct the series of representations of the groups of diffeomorphisms of Riemann surfaces enumerated by the points of Thurston compactification of Teichm"uller (Teichmuller) space.
